Home for the Holidays: These darling kitten faces are those of Colin and Corey, a pair of bonded brothers. The boys are very well-socialized, super friendly, and love to play. Colin, a brown, black, and tan tabby, likes to play fetch with his toy mouse, retrieve it from across the room, and bring it right back to drop in a lap. This game of fetch will continue over and over again! Corey, black with white patches on his chest and stomach, likes to sit on laps and get attention, and is very playful. He loves his toys, but may be shy at first until he becomes familiar. Both are lap cats who snuggle on the sofa with their foster mom. Could you give them the love and nurturing they crave?
